Braciole (Italian Beef) Recipe

2nd January 2009

Ingredients

  • 1 lb. thinly sliced beef
  • 1/3 cup grated Parmesan cheese
  • 1 1/2 tbs. butter or margarine
  • 1 tbs. parsley
  • 1/4 clove garlic
  • 3 cups tomato sauce
  • 1 tsp. salt
  • 1/2 tsp. pepper

Directions

  • Flatten steak and cut into strips about 3 inches wide.
  • On each strip, rub with garlic and dot with butter.
  • Then sprinkle parsley, cheese, salt, and pepper.
  • Tie with string or toothpick.
  • Brown in Extra Virgin Olive Oil.
  • Cook in tomato sauce for 1 hour.

Mom’s Italian Ricotta Cheese Pie Recipe

24th November 2008

Crust

  • 1-cup flour
  • 1/4 tsp. salt
  • 1/4-cup water
  • 1/4-cup soft butter
  • 1/4 tsp. anise
  • Greased 10″ pie plate

Filling

  • 4 eggs
  • 1-cup sugar
  • 2 lbs. Ricotta cheese
  • 1 tsp. Anise
  • 2 tsp. Vanilla
  • 3 tsp. Lemon juice

Directions

  • Crust: Mix flour, water, butter, salt, and anise.
  • Roll out and put in 10 inch pie plate.
  • Filling: Mix eggs, sugar, ricotta, anise, vanilla, and lemon juice and pour into crust.
  • Bake at 400 for 15 minutes.
  • Then bake at 350 for 45 minutes.

Italian Meat Loaf Recipe

17th June 2008

Ingredients

  • 1 1/2 lb. ground beef
  • 1/2 lb. ground pork
  • 3 tbsp. chopped parsley
  • 2 eggs
  • 1/4 cup olive oil
  • 1/3 cup Romano cheese, grated
  • 1 tsp. salt
  • 1/2 tsp. black or red pepper
  • 1/3 cup green pepper, chopped
  • 1/3 cup onion, finely chopped

Directions

  • Mix meats, eggs, grated cheese, and spices.
  • Pour oil in 5 by 10 loaf pan and then place meat mixture in pan.
  • Cover and bake at 350 for 45 minutes.
  • Slice and serve hot.

Veal and Peppers Recipe

23rd March 2008

Ingredients

  • 2 lbs. veal cutlets cut into 2 in. pieces
  • 6 green peppers cut into 2 in. pieces
  • 2 medium onions, chopped
  • 1/4 cup cooking wine
  • 1/4-cup olive oil
  • 1 can of plum tomatoes
  • 1 tsp. salt
  • 1/2 tsp. red or black pepper

Directions

  • Brown onions in olive oil, then take out of pan.
  • Sauté cut veal in oil and add onion and peppers.
  • Add wine and let cook for 10 minutes on medium heat.
  • Add tomatoes and cover pan.
  • Cook slowly for 45 minutes.

Veal Scaloppini Recipe

17th February 2008

Ingredients

  • 1 lb. veal cutlets (cut about 1/2 inch thick)
  • 1/2 cup flour
  • 1/2 tsp. salt
  • 1/2 tsp. black or red pepper
  • 1 clover garlic, chopped
  • 1/2 cup olive oil
  • 2 cups tomatoes (canned)
  • 1/2 tsp. chopped parsley
  • 1/2 tsp. oregano

Directions

  • Wipe veal with clean damp cloth and flatten. Cut into 1 inch pieces.
  • Combine flour, salt and pepper and then coat veal with this mixture.
  • Heat garlic and oil in large skillet with tight fitting cover until garlic is lightly browned.
  • Add veal and slowly brown both sides.
  • While veal is browning, combine tomatoes, salt chopped parsley, oregano, and pepper.
  • Slowly add this mixture to the browned veal.
  • Cover skillet and simmer about 25 minutes or until veal is tender.

Mom’s Italian Meatballs Recipe

16th September 2007

Ingredients

  • 1 lb. ground beef (at least 90% lean)
  • 1 egg
  • 1/4 cup of chopped fresh onion
  • 1 tsp. salt
  • 1 tsp. parsley
  • 1 tbs. of grated Romano cheese (or Parmesan)
  • 2 slices of Italian Bread

Directions

  • Blend all ingredients (except meat) in blender.
  • Mix liquid with ground beef in large mixing bowl.
  • Wet your hands when forming the meatballs.
  • Add meatballs to sauce as you make them.
  • Cook in sauce for at least an hour.
  • Makes 12 of the best meatballs you have ever tasted.
